Footballer Thierry Henry's home has been ransacked and his cleaner tied up during the burglary.

Police sources confirmed they are investigating a break-in at the north London home of the Arsenal player.

A Metropolitan Police spokesman says Camden CID is investigating an aggravated burglary at an address in Hampstead, between 6pm and 7pm on Wednesday December 5.

"The suspect gained entry to the premises, tied up a female cleaner before ransacking the property and leaving with a quantity of property," the spokesman said.

"The victim suffered from bruises and shock but did not require hospital treatment."
